The Secret Weapon
7 pp · Anthropomorphic-Funny Animals
Bugs BunnyYosemite Sam

In "The Secret Weapon," retired pirate Sam ships a crate of "Atomic Brand Cat Food" while Bugs Bunny tags along for the ride. Bored on deck, Bugs pulls a prank by raising Sam’s old pirate flags, including the infamous Jolly Roger—only to trigger a panic when the Maharajah of Richypan, mistaking the crate for a weapon, surrenders his jewels and flees, leaving Sam and Bugs to face a far more dangerous kind of trouble.
